Metric Thread Gauge M3–M12 | Thread Template for Workshop & 3D Printing

Precisely engineered metric thread gauge for M3, M4, M5, M6, M8, M10 and M12 including common pitches

Ideal for quick screw identification, checking internal threads, inspecting 3D printed parts, or as a practical thread template in the workshop

 

This thread gauge was developed in Fusion and specifically optimized for FDM 3D printing. The included Bambu Studio print profiles are adjusted to automatically compensate for typical filament tolerances

✔ Supported Thread Sizes

M3 · M4 · M5 · M6 · M8 · M10 · M12
(including common metric pitches)

✔ Optimized Print Settings

  • Layer height: 0.12 mm
  • 3 walls
  • Automatic contour hole compensation: active
  • No support needed
  • Clean thread fit without post-processing
